Sr. Software Engineer
Summary
Deployed and support multiple Kafka cluster of 100+ machine.
Designed distributed transaction algorithms and auto-sharding algorithms for distributed databases and distributed caching solution using consensus algorithm.
Designed high performance storage engine using RocksDB for serving online traffic with low latency.
Major Achievements: Designed and ship, a solution for streaming database change to a large cluster of Ads serving machines using a peer2peer algorithms.
This reduced the server cost and significantly reduced the delay from change to Ads campaign change until reflected on Ads serving.
Expectations
Would like an opportunity to services or tool that would be used by a large number of third party developer.
Also make best use of my experience with Distributed database internals.
Employment Preferences
Expected Base Salary
**5,000 USD / year